Create a bespoke document in minutes, or upload and review your own.
Get your first 2 documents free
Your data doesn't train Genie's AI
You keep IP ownership of your information
Stock Purchase Agreement
I need a stock purchase agreement for the acquisition of 15% equity in a private German company, with provisions for a due diligence period, representations and warranties from the seller, and a payment structure that includes an initial deposit and subsequent installments. The agreement should comply with German corporate law and include a dispute resolution clause specifying arbitration in Berlin.
What is a Stock Purchase Agreement?
A Stock Purchase Agreement documents the sale of company shares between parties under German corporate law. It outlines key terms like the purchase price, number of shares changing hands, and when the transfer will happen. For German GmbHs and AGs, these agreements must comply with specific notarization requirements set out in the Commercial Code (HGB).
Beyond just recording the transaction, these agreements protect both buyers and sellers by including warranties about the company's condition, setting conditions for closing the deal, and defining how to handle disputes. They're especially important in German M&A deals, where strict liability rules make clear documentation essential. The agreement typically needs approval from existing shareholders and must be registered with the commercial register (Handelsregister).
When should you use a Stock Purchase Agreement?
Use a Stock Purchase Agreement when buying or selling shares in a German company, particularly for significant ownership transfers. This agreement becomes essential in private deals between shareholders, company acquisitions, or when bringing in new strategic investors. Under German law, it provides the necessary legal framework for share transfers in both GmbHs and AGs.
The agreement proves especially valuable during complex transactions involving multiple shareholders, staged payments, or specific performance conditions. German businesses often need it when structuring international investments, implementing succession plans, or during corporate restructuring. Having this agreement in place helps prevent future disputes and ensures compliance with German corporate regulations and tax requirements.
What are the different types of Stock Purchase Agreement?
- Stock Purchase Contract: The standard form used for direct share purchases, typically containing core elements like purchase price, transfer mechanics, and basic warranties. Common variations include simplified versions for small private transactions, comprehensive agreements for M&A deals with extensive due diligence provisions, staged purchase agreements with milestone-based payments, and international versions adapted for cross-border transactions under German law. Each type adjusts key sections like representations, conditions precedent, and post-closing obligations based on transaction complexity.
Who should typically use a Stock Purchase Agreement?
- Company Shareholders: Both individual and corporate shareholders use Stock Purchase Agreements when selling their stakes in German GmbHs or AGs. This includes majority owners, minority investors, and venture capital firms.
- Corporate Legal Teams: In-house lawyers draft and review these agreements, ensuring compliance with German corporate law and protecting company interests.
- External Law Firms: German corporate lawyers typically prepare complex versions, especially for international transactions or large-scale M&A deals.
- Notaries: Required by German law to authenticate share transfers, they verify identities and ensure proper execution of the agreement.
- Company Management: Directors and officers often negotiate terms and must ensure proper corporate approvals.
How do you write a Stock Purchase Agreement?
- Company Details: Gather current shareholder register, articles of association, and commercial register excerpts from the Handelsregister.
- Share Information: Document exact number of shares, share classes, and nominal values being transferred.
- Purchase Terms: Determine price, payment structure, and any earn-out conditions.
- Due Diligence: Collect key financial statements, material contracts, and ongoing obligations.
- Approvals: Check required shareholder consents and regulatory clearances.
- Documentation: Our platform generates comprehensive Stock Purchase Agreements tailored to German law, ensuring all mandatory elements are included correctly.
What should be included in a Stock Purchase Agreement?
- Party Details: Full legal names, addresses, and registration numbers of buyer, seller, and company.
- Share Description: Precise details of shares being transferred, including class, nominal value, and percentage of total capital.
- Purchase Price: Clear payment terms, timing, and any adjustments or earn-out mechanisms.
- Warranties: Standard German law representations about share ownership, company status, and financial condition.
- Transfer Mechanics: Notarization requirements and commercial register filing procedures.
- Closing Conditions: Required approvals, regulatory clearances, and timing of execution.
- Governing Law: Our platform automatically includes all these elements in compliance with German corporate law, ensuring nothing is missed.
What's the difference between a Stock Purchase Agreement and an Asset Purchase Agreement?
A Stock Purchase Agreement differs significantly from an Asset Purchase Agreement in German business transactions. While both involve company acquisitions, they serve distinct purposes and carry different legal implications under German law.
- Transaction Object: Stock Purchase Agreements transfer company ownership through share sales, while Asset Purchase Agreements deal with specific company assets, equipment, or property.
- Legal Complexity: Share transfers require notarization and commercial register updates in Germany, whereas asset transfers often need individual documentation for each asset type.
- Liability Transfer: Stock purchases automatically transfer all company obligations and liabilities, while asset purchases allow buyers to select specific assets and exclude unwanted liabilities.
- Tax Implications: Share deals typically trigger share transfer taxes, while asset deals may involve VAT and real estate transfer tax for German properties.
- Third-Party Consents: Asset deals often require individual contract transfers and multiple third-party approvals, unlike stock deals which preserve existing contracts.
Download our whitepaper on the future of AI in Legal
ұԾ’s Security Promise
Genie is the safest place to draft. Here’s how we prioritise your privacy and security.
Your documents are private:
We do not train on your data; ұԾ’s AI improves independently
All data stored on Genie is private to your organisation
Your documents are protected:
Your documents are protected by ultra-secure 256-bit encryption
Our bank-grade security infrastructure undergoes regular external audits
We are ISO27001 certified, so your data is secure
Organizational security
You retain IP ownership of your documents
You have full control over your data and who gets to see it
Innovation in privacy:
Genie partnered with the Computational Privacy Department at Imperial College London
Together, we ran a £1 million research project on privacy and anonymity in legal contracts
Want to know more?
Visit our for more details and real-time security updates.
Read our Privacy Policy.